We are seeking an Executive Assistant to the CEO to provide critical support that maximizes the CEO's efficiency and effectiveness.
In this role, the Executive Assistant will be a key partner in managing operations, accelerating sales processes, supporting technology initiatives, and driving ASC's mission forward with precision and energy.
Key Responsibilities:- Manage and maintain the CEO’s calendar, sales appointments, demos, meetings, and travel logistics, ensuring all activities align with top business priorities.
- Set and coordinate meetings with prospective clients across staffing firms, government agencies, healthcare organizations, and international distributors.
- Support sales efforts by handling appointment setting, initial objections, and ensuring lead follow-ups and CRM tracking are executed consistently.
- Prepare agendas, reports, CRM updates, and presentations to ensure every meeting is actionable and productive.
- Act as the first point of communication on behalf of the CEO to internal teams, external prospects, customers, and technology partners.
- Monitor and manage email communications, CRM records, and customer interactions to ensure smooth daily operations.
- Collaborate with technology teams on API integration projects, HRIS systems, CRM platforms, and SaaS solutions related to
- Assist with special assignments, executive projects, contracts, and strategic initiatives with a strong sense of urgency.
- Handle sensitive information with absolute discretion, loyalty, and professionalism.
- Maintain organized records, reports, digital files, and communications to support operational excellence.
